Globe/wire say GM unveils plans for e-vehicle platform

2017-11-16 05:54 ET - In the News

The Globe and Mail reports in its Thursday, Nov. 16, edition that chief executive officer Mary Barra says General Motors plans to launch a new family of electric vehicles in 2021 that will cost less to build and make a profit for the automaker. A Reuters dispatch to The Globe reports that Ms. Barra's plans are a direct challenge to money-losing electric-vehicle specialist Tesla. Electric and autonomous vehicles are widely seen as the keystones of future transport, but Tesla, Ford Motor and others are still working out how to make money on them. Ms. Barra says GM is looking to break out of that pattern by developing an all-new electric-vehicle platform that will accommodate multiple sizes and segments, to be sold by different GM brands in the United States and China. In October, GM said it planned to launch 20 new electric vehicles by 2023. By comparison, rival Ford has said it plans to introduce 13 "electrified" vehicles by 2022. Ms. Barra says GM aims to be selling one million electric vehicles a year by 2026, many of them in China. GM's cost reduction efforts on electric vehicles centre on a new battery system that will be more than 30 per cent cheaper than the one that powers the Chevrolet Bolt.
